Abstract:In recent years, progress has been made in several aspects of women 0 s health world-wide. Women 0 s life expectancy has increased, a significant reduction in maternal mortality has been achieved and access to education for girls is getting better. With better access to contraception and safe abortion, women 0 s reproductive health is improving.
